1001:2048
很明显,一开始看错题了。。。sad
这题目我感觉挺卡时间的。。。
dp[i][j]:在选择2^i的时候,选择的和为j*2^i到(j+1)*2^i-1时候的情况。
#include
#include
#include
#include
#include
#include
#include
#include
using namespace std;
#define LL ...
分类:
其他好文 时间:
2014-08-20 16:26:32
阅读次数:
169
思路:先把所有的串连接成一个串,串写串之前用没出现过的字符隔开,然后求后缀;对height数组分组二分求得最长的公共前缀,公共前缀所在的串一定要是不同的,不然就不是所有串的公共前缀了,然后记下下标和长度即可。
刚开始理解错题意,然后不知道怎么写,然后看别人题解也不知道怎么意思,后面看了好久才知道题目意思理解错了。
时间四千多ms,别人才一百多ms,不知道别人怎么做的……
#include
#...
分类:
其他好文 时间:
2014-08-15 14:42:29
阅读次数:
277
先是看错题意。。然后知道题意之后写了发dp..无限TLE..实在是不知道怎么优化了,跑了遍数据是对的,就当作理论AC掉好了。。#pragma warning(disable:4996)#include #include #include #include #include #include #inc...
分类:
其他好文 时间:
2014-08-15 01:25:36
阅读次数:
324
一开始看错题了,后来发现原来是在一颗带权的树上面求出距离每一个点的最长距离,做两次dfs就好,具体的看注释?#include #include #include #include #include #include #include #include #include #include #inclu...
分类:
其他好文 时间:
2014-08-08 15:35:06
阅读次数:
236
这题 自己没做出来啊 擦看了别人的解题报告 才发现自己读错题了 草。。。我理解成( i , j )周围的4个格子不能取 。。。 题目给的图 都没有仔细看那就懒得分析了 直接贴下别人的 自己的思维也被定势了 不能有新的做法了 ---传送---touch me注意将 数组开大点。。。其实 这题就是求 每...
分类:
其他好文 时间:
2014-08-08 01:55:35
阅读次数:
180
1514 书架0人推荐收藏发题解提交代码报错题目描述输入描述输出描述样例输入样例输出提示题目描述Description 小 T有一个很大的书柜。这个书柜的构造有些独特,即书柜里的书是从上至下堆放成一列。她用 1 到 n 的正整数给每本书都编了号。 小 T 在看书的时候,每次取出一本书,看完后放回.....
分类:
其他好文 时间:
2014-08-05 03:03:18
阅读次数:
269
问题:删除数组中和elem相等的元素,并且返回新数组大小。英语不好。。。读错题了。。class Solution {public: int removeElement(int A[], int n, int elem) { int i,j; for(int i=0;...
分类:
其他好文 时间:
2014-08-01 23:03:22
阅读次数:
223
简单DP,可以理解为背包问题的变式。(想当初苯渣会错题意,以为只要输出任意一组解啊!结果一趟DFS在第14个点上WA三次啊!TUT)(第14个点上WA的一定是用贪心或一趟DFS做的!)首先找到10000以内的super_prime,共201个。(不是打表- -)这部分代码可以在行到行找到。然后DP:...
分类:
其他好文 时间:
2014-07-31 16:35:46
阅读次数:
199
不容易啊,终于可以补第二个题了!!
顺便说一句:模版写残了就不要怪出题人啊 ~ (这残废模版研究了好长时间才找出错)
题目大意:
有一个n*m的矩阵,每一个格子里都将有一个数。给你每一行数字之和和每一列数字之和。求每一个位置能填0~k之间的哪个数。如果有多种可能输出“Not Unique”,如果没有解输出“Impossible”,如果一组解则将其输出。
解题思路:
最大流...
这题 感觉很容易读错题意的~~ touch me这题 要是 数据再大点 就不那么容易做了 用hash才2000的数组 太轻松了要是弄个10^9....就要换方法了一开始 我一直担心 O(n^2)的去预处理数组 会不会导致超时 ...还好n就1000这里的第K大 让我WA了3 4发... 这...
分类:
其他好文 时间:
2014-07-27 10:25:32
阅读次数:
174